Reduction Gears
Torque and Speed Optimization
Reduction gears play a key role in optimizing torque and speed in your excavator. These gears reduce the rotational speed of the motor while increasing torque, allowing the machine to handle heavy loads with ease. This combination of reduced speed and enhanced power is essential for tasks that demand high levels of force, such as lifting or digging.
The design of reduction gears ensures that your excavator operates efficiently under varying conditions. By balancing speed and torque, these gears prevent the machine from overexerting itself, reducing the risk of mechanical failure. Their contribution to overall performance makes them a critical component of your excavator’s gear system.

Final Drive Gears
Powering Excavator Movement Across Terrains
Final drive gears play a crucial role in enabling your excavator to move seamlessly across various terrains. These gears transfer power from the drive train to the tracks or wheels, ensuring smooth and efficient movement. By reducing speed and increasing torque, they provide the necessary force to propel your machine through challenging environments, such as rocky landscapes or muddy construction sites.
The design of final drive gears allows them to handle some of the heaviest loads and most intense forces. This capability ensures that your excavator maintains stability and performance, even when navigating uneven surfaces or steep inclines. Without these gears, your machine would struggle to achieve the traction and power needed for demanding tasks.
“Final drive gears reduce speed and generate torque, carrying some of the heaviest loads and most intense forces.” This highlights their importance in maintaining the reliability and efficiency of your excavator during operation.

Common Issues with Excavator Gears and How to Address Them
Gear Slippage and Its Causes
Gear slippage occurs when the gears fail to engage properly, leading to a loss of power transmission. This issue often stems from worn-out gear teeth, improper alignment, or insufficient lubrication. When the teeth of the gears wear down, they lose their ability to grip effectively, causing the gears to slip during operation. Misalignment can also disrupt the smooth engagement of gears, further contributing to this problem.
To address gear slippage, start by inspecting the gears for visible signs of wear or damage. Check for uneven or chipped teeth, as these are common indicators of wear. Ensure that the gears are properly aligned within the system. Misaligned gears require immediate adjustment to restore their functionality. Additionally, verify that the lubrication levels are adequate. Insufficient lubrication increases friction, which accelerates wear and leads to slippage. Noise and Vibration Problems in Gear Systems
Unusual noise and excessive vibrations in your excavator’s gear system often indicate underlying issues. These problems may result from misaligned gears, insufficient lubrication, or damaged components. Noise typically arises when the gears grind against each other due to improper alignment or lack of lubrication. Vibrations, on the other hand, can signal imbalances or loose connections within the gear assembly.
To resolve noise and vibration problems, start by checking the alignment of the gears. Misaligned gears require immediate correction to restore smooth operation. Inspect the gear teeth for damage, as chipped or broken teeth can cause grinding noises. Ensure that the lubrication is adequate and evenly applied across all gear surfaces. Proper lubrication reduces friction and minimizes noise.
If vibrations persist, examine the entire gear assembly for loose or worn-out components. Tighten any loose connections and replace damaged parts as needed. Regular maintenance, including lubrication and alignment checks, helps prevent these issues.
